The History of Toy Story

Toy Story was released in 1995 and was the first feature-length computer-animated film. It was a groundbreaking movie and is still considered a classic today. The movie tells the story of a group of toys led by Woody, a cowboy doll, and Buzz Lightyear, a space ranger toy.

Toy Story was a massive success, grossing over $370 million worldwide. It was also nominated for three Academy Awards, including Best Original Screenplay. The success of Toy Story led to two sequels, Toy Story 2 and Toy Story 3.

Toy Story 2

Toy Story 2

Toy Story 2 was released in 1999 and was also a massive success. It grossed over $485 million worldwide and was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Original Song. The movie continued the story of Woody and the other toys, this time with Woody being stolen by a toy collector.

Toy Story 2 was originally supposed to be a direct-to-video release, but after the success of the first movie, it was decided to release it in theaters. The success of Toy Story 2 led to the production of Toy Story 3.

Toy Story 3

Toy Story 3 was released in 2010 and was once again a massive success. It grossed over $1 billion worldwide and was nominated for five Academy Awards, including Best Picture. The movie continued the story of Woody, Buzz, and the other toys, this time with Andy, their owner, getting ready to go to college.

Toy Story 3 was marketed as the final movie in the franchise, with many people assuming that it would be the last movie. The movie had a poignant ending, with Andy giving his toys to a young girl named Bonnie.
